Median rent is 10% lower in Los Angeles ($1,879/mo vs $2,082/mo). Buying is cheaper in Anaheim, where the median home runs $771,700 versus $879,500. Households earn more in Anaheim ($90,583 vs $80,366 a year). Overall, the two cities have a nearly identical cost of living index (113.3).

How much is rent in Anaheim vs Los Angeles?
Median rent is $2,082/mo in Anaheim, CA and $1,879/mo in Los Angeles, CA. Los Angeles, CA has the lower rent by about 10%.
Which has higher salaries — Anaheim or Los Angeles?
Median household income is $90,583 in Anaheim, CA and $80,366 in Los Angeles, CA. Anaheim, CA has the higher median income. Note that BLS occupational wages in the table above show wages for specific jobs.
